Infrastructure Strategy Group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Infrastructure Strategy Group in the United States is $45.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$92,886. Salaries at Infrastructure Strategy Group typically range from $39 to $51 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Infrastructure Strategy Group
Infrastructure Strategy Group is a company that operates in the Management Consulting industry. It employs 21-50 people and has $5M-$10M of revenue. The company is headquartered in Denver, Colorado.
